What Is a Patriarchal Blessing and Why It Matters

A patriarchal blessing is a personal message from God. It comes through a Patriarch / Stake Patriarch who gives the blessing under the Holy Spirit / Inspiration of the Spirit. The blessing offers personal counsel from the Lord, guidance, and eternal direction. It is meant only for you and is recorded so you can return to it often.

This blessing is not about predicting every detail of life. Instead, it helps you stay on the right path. The patriarchal blessing purposes include strengthening your faith, reminding you of your eternal worth, and connecting you to God’s promises.

Understanding the Purpose of a Patriarchal Blessing

The patriarchal blessing purposes are simple yet powerful. First, it provides personal counsel from the Lord, reminding you that He knows and loves you. Second, it includes a declaration of lineage that connects you to the house of Israel. This connection shows that you are part of the Seed of Abraham and share in the Abrahamic covenant.

The scriptures teach us that Abraham’s descendants would receive covenant blessings, spread the gospel, and bless the world (see Abraham 2:9; Abraham 2:11; Genesis 17:5–6; Abraham 3:14). When you receive your blessing, you are reminded of these gospel promises and your role in God’s eternal plan.

When to Receive Your Patriarchal Blessing: Key Considerations

There is no single age or stage in life when every member should receive their blessing. Some people receive it in youth, often during missionary preparation, while others wait until adulthood. The important thing is to seek the right timing through prayer and counsel with your bishops / bishopric.

Your spiritual timeline is unique. God will guide you to the right moment when you are ready to hear His voice. For some, that moment comes quickly after baptism; for others, it may take years. Both journeys are equally valid.

Spiritual Preparation Before Receiving Your Blessing

Preparation matters. Before your patriarchal blessing, strengthen your faith in Heavenly Father and Jesus Christ. Daily prayer, scripture study, and repentance help you prepare your heart.

The worthy baptized members who seek blessings with a humble spirit often feel the guidance more deeply. Think of your preparation as polishing your soul so the Lord’s words can shine clearly in your life.

Age and Readiness: How to Know the Right Time

Some members receive their blessing at a young age, sometimes as early as 11, while others wait until later. Worthy members of the Church often receive it before serving a mission, but this is not a rule. Even seniors have received blessings and felt peace from them.

Readiness is not about age but about your heart. If you desire guidance and feel prepared to follow counsel, you are ready. If doubts remain, continue preparing spiritually until you feel peace.

Common Questions About When to Receive Your Patriarchal Blessing

Many new members of the Church ask if they can receive their blessing soon after baptism. The answer is yes, once they feel prepared. Others wonder if they must wait until missionary preparation, but this is not required.

Some adults worry it’s too late. But there is no maximum age. Members as old as 93 have received their blessings. What matters most is a sincere desire and readiness to hear God’s words.

The Role of Personal Worthiness and Faith

Receiving a blessing requires worthiness. You must meet with your bishops / bishopric first. This interview ensures you are spiritually ready and treating the experience with reverence.

Faith is also key. The blessing only carries meaning when you believe in the promises of God. A heart full of humility and belief makes it possible for you to feel His voice and direction clearly.
